Implementing CRM: Best Practices

We share tips and insights on effectively implementing a CRM system in your organization, including planning, training, data migration, and change management.

Implementing CRM: Best Practices
Implementing CRM: Best Practices

This is the third article in CRM blog series. You can access the other articles in the series from the links below.

  1. Introduction to CRM: Learn the Basics
  2. Choosing the Right CRM for Your Business
  3. Implementing CRM: Best Practices - (You are reading this article.)
  4. Enhancing Customer Engagement with CRM
  5. Leveraging CRM for Sales Automation
  6. CRM and Customer Service Success
  7. Measuring CRM Success: KPI and Analytics

Choosing the Right CRM Software for Your Business

Choosing the right CRM software for your company is crucial for a successful implementation. With many different options available, it’s essential to assess your specific needs and requirements. You should consider factors like scalability, ease of use, integration capabilities, and industry-specific features. Research customer reviews, request demos, and compare pricing models. Then you can prioritize a CRM solution that aligns with your business goals and offers robust support. Also remember, selecting the right CRM software sets the foundation for effective customer relationship management and drives business growth.

Setting Clear Goals and Objectives for CRM Implementation

Setting clear goals and objectives is a vital step in CRM implementation. Before diving into the process, it’s crucial to define what you aim to achieve through the CRM system. Start by identifying the specific pain points or challenges you want to address, such as improving customer satisfaction, increasing sales, or streamlining communication. Once you have a clear understanding of your objectives, establish measurable goals that align with them. These goals should be specific, attainable, relevant, and time-bound (SMART goals). For instance, a goal could be to increase customer retention by 15% within the next six months. Setting clear goals and objectives not only provides direction but also helps track progress and evaluate the effectiveness of your CRM implementation.

Additionally, involve key stakeholders from different departments to ensure their input and alignment with the CRM objectives. Conduct collaborative meetings and workshops to gather insights and perspectives. This collaborative approach fosters a sense of ownership and encourages cross-functional cooperation. Furthermore, communicate the goals and objectives to the entire organization, emphasizing the benefits and positive impact on individual roles and the overall business. When everyone is on the same page regarding the CRM objectives, it becomes easier to mobilize efforts, gain support, and work towards achieving the desired outcomes.

Obtaining Buy-In from Stakeholders and Building a Cross-Functional Team

Obtaining buy-in from stakeholders and building a cross-functional team is essential for successful CRM implementation. Stakeholders, including executives, department heads, and end-users, play a critical role in shaping the CRM strategy and ensuring its adoption throughout the organization. Start by identifying key stakeholders and understanding their perspectives and concerns. Present a clear business case for CRM implementation, highlighting the benefits it can bring to their specific areas of responsibility. You should engage stakeholders in open discussions, address their questions and doubts, and emphasize the positive impact CRM can have on productivity, efficiency, and customer satisfaction.

In addition to stakeholder buy-in, building a cross-functional team is crucial to leverage diverse expertise and ensure a smooth implementation process. Establish a team consisting of representatives from different departments, such as sales, marketing, customer service, and IT. Each member should bring a unique perspective and understanding of their department’s needs and challenges. Encourage active participation and collaboration among team members to foster a sense of ownership and accountability. By involving a cross-functional team, you can ensure that the CRM implementation aligns with the requirements of each department and that all relevant perspectives are considered during the decision-making process. This approach can also facilitate effective communication, knowledge sharing, and a smoother transition to the new CRM system.

Customizing and Configuring the CRM System to Fit Your Business Needs

Customizing and configuring the CRM system to fit your business needs is a crucial step in ensuring its effectiveness and alignment with your unique processes. Every organization has specific requirements and workflows that must be accommodated within the CRM solution.

You can start by thoroughly analyzing your existing processes and identifying areas where customization is necessary. This should include creating custom fields, defining unique data structures, and configuring automation rules. Tailor the CRM system to match your terminology, sales stages, and customer segmentation.

Additionally, leverage the flexibility of the CRM platform to integrate with other business systems, such as marketing automation or customer support tools. By customizing and configuring the CRM system to fit your business needs, you can optimize efficiency, streamline operations, and provide a personalized experience for both your team and customers.

Training and Onboarding Employees for CRM Adoption

Training and onboarding employees for CRM adoption is another critical aspect of successful implementation. Introducing a new CRM system requires proper training to ensure that employees understand its functionalities, benefits, and how to effectively utilize it in their day-to-day tasks. You can start by developing a comprehensive training program that caters to different user roles and levels of expertise. Offer a combination of training methods, such as in-person workshops, online tutorials, and interactive demos, to accommodate various learning preferences.

During the onboarding process, emphasize the relevance of CRM to each employee’s role and how it can enhance their productivity and job performance. Provide hands-on training and practical examples that demonstrate how the CRM system can support their specific tasks, whether it’s lead management, customer communication, or reporting. Encourage employees to ask questions, provide feedback, and address any concerns they may have. Additionally, consider appointing power users or CRM champions within each department who can serve as resources and offer ongoing support to their colleagues. By investing in comprehensive training and onboarding, you empower employees to embrace the CRM system with confidence, increasing adoption rates and maximizing its potential benefits for the entire organization.

Ongoing Monitoring, Evaluation, and Continuous Improvement of CRM Processes

Ongoing monitoring, evaluation, and continuous improvement of CRM processes are crucial for maximizing the effectiveness of your CRM implementation. Once the CRM system is up and running, it’s very important to establish metrics and key performance indicators (KPIs) that align with your CRM objectives. You need to regularly monitor and evaluate these metrics to track the progress and effectiveness of your CRM processes. Analyze data on customer interactions, sales performance, and customer satisfaction to identify trends, patterns, and areas for improvement.

In addition to monitoring metrics, gather feedback from employees who use the CRM system on a regular basis. Conduct surveys, hold focus groups, or establish an open feedback channel where users can share their experiences, challenges, and suggestions. This valuable input can provide insights into usability issues, training gaps, or additional features that could enhance the CRM system’s functionality and usability. Use this feedback to iteratively improve and optimize the CRM processes and workflows, ensuring that the system continues to meet the evolving needs of your business and users.

Moreover, regularly review and update CRM documentation, training materials, and standard operating procedures to reflect any changes or enhancements made to the CRM system. Provide ongoing training and refresher sessions to keep employees up to date with new features or improvements. By embracing a mindset of continuous improvement, you can enhance the effectiveness of your CRM processes, drive greater efficiency, and continuously strive to deliver exceptional customer experiences.

Sign up for our newsletter

We never spam. We send approximately one email about our blog posts and product features per month.

Marketing permission: I give my consent to Hipcall to be in touch with me via email using the information I have provided in this form for the purpose of news, updates and marketing.